  • Page 65: Data Encryption

    AES (*1) or Fujitsu Original Encryption can be selected as the encryption method. The Fujitsu Original Encryp- tion method uses a Fujitsu original algorithm that has been specifically created for ETERNUS AF storage sys- tems.

  • Page 67: Firmware Data Encryption

    Fujitsu Original Encryption method. The Fujitsu Original Encryption method that is based on AES technology uses a Fujitsu original algorithm that has been specifically created for ETERNUS AF storage systems. The Fujitsu Origi- nal Encryption method has practically the same security level as AES-128 and the conversion speed for the Fujit- su Original Encryption method is faster than AES.
